Bilal Akhtar <bilalakhtar@ubuntu.com> writes:
>> I noticed you patched src/xmalloc.c to not exit in xmalloc_fatal.  Does
>> the rest of the code handle this change correctly?
>
> Yes it does. This change has been around for more than a month in Debian
> experimental and Ubuntu natty, and through some tests I found no
> problems with it so far.

Did you ever run into an out of memory condition where the modified
xmalloc_fatal is called?

I did "sabotage" xmalloc to always call xmalloc_fatal using the attached
patch. With this the test suite failed with a segmentation fault. So it
seems the upstream code does *not* handle xmalloc_fatal returning
correctly:

--8<---------------cut here---------------start------------->8---
make  check-TESTS
make[3]: Entering directory `/build/sbuild-liboauth_0.9.4-1.1-amd64-mIm2gv/liboauth-0.9.4'
Out of memory./bin/bash: line 5: 23730 Segmentation fault      ${dir}$tst
FAIL: tests/tcwiki
Out of memory./bin/bash: line 5: 23754 Segmentation fault      ${dir}$tst
FAIL: tests/tceran
Out of memory./bin/bash: line 5: 23778 Segmentation fault      ${dir}$tst
FAIL: tests/tcother
========================================
3 of 3 tests failed
--8<---------------cut here---------------end--------------->8---
